Al Seeger compiled a career batting average of .247 with 11 home runs and 45 RBI in his 370-game career with the Hickory Rebels, Lafayette Oilers, Des Moines Bruins and Burlington Bees. He began playing during the 1952 season and last took the field during the 1957 campaign.
